Daily DCE Review 29/6/21

Iron ore futures suffered a sharp fall in the morning session, before recovering some positions during the afternoon session. The futures of Dalian Commodity Exchange (DCE) for September delivery then dived down by 2.66% day-on-day or RMB 31.50 to RMB 1,196/mt at the close of day trading session on Tuesday. Daily DCE Review 28/6/21

Iron ore futures started the week on gains, as market participants held their concerns over supply tightness and low port inventory. The futures of Dalian Commodity Exchange (DCE) for September delivery then went up by 2.09% day-on-day or RMB 24.50 to RMB 1,196/mt during the day trading session on Monday.
